Output addc661eff6289f91aa6025b5a1a58a910997bd0c96f1b09f0b39b9d24468363:1

value
19922276
script pubkey
OP_0 OP_PUSHBYTES_20 21c940430f4c9fa8d7583526f3efc009326f62f3
address
ltc1qy8y5qsc0fj06346cx5n08m7qpyex7chn6w4uqn
transaction
addc661eff6289f91aa6025b5a1a58a910997bd0c96f1b09f0b39b9d24468363
spent
true